St Vincent and the Grenadines and St. Vincent Electricity Services Limited (VINLEC), the national utility, have a long history of utilizing renewable energy for electricity generation. Hydropower has been a part of the generation mix since the early 1950s, and in the late 1980s it represented half of the electricity produced by the utility.

"Most of the islands in the Grenadines are fully dependent on fossil fuel including Mayreau, Canouan, Union Island—and the broader concept was to look at these islands and see how to make them renewable with solar, wind, and battery storage," said Ellsworth Dacon, Director of the St. Vincent and the Grenadines Energy Unit.

The Microgrid Project is part of St. Vincent and the Grenadines'' shift toward increasing the utilization of renewable energy technologies. Currently VINLEC utilizes hydro and solar energy to provide just under 20% of electricity production on the main island of Saint Vincent. along with 100-250 kWh of battery storage.

Energy storage battery systems are often combined with renewable energy sources – including wind and solar power - to smooth-out system varying and intermittent outputs. They usually contain bi-directional DC-AC inverters for grid interfacing and bi-directional DC-DC converters that independently control energy flows to and from each battery
